Over the past few months, I’ve been spending a lot of time working on something that sits somewhere between technology, operations and project management.
This is something I’ve seen repeatedly throughout my career: Most businesses don't have a software problem. They have an operations problem.
They have software everywhere. Forms, spreadsheets, messaging apps, accounting systems, CRMs, document repositories, booking platforms, websites and dozens of little processes that have gradually evolved over time.
The problem is that they don't necessarily work together, and that’s where the interesting work starts.
